At the Back of the North Wind
Diamond is the young son of a coachman, a gentle boy who sleeps in the hayloft above the horses. One cold night a tall and beautiful woman appears at the chink in his wall, calling herself North Wind, and carries him out into the sky. She is at once tender and terrible, a nurse to some and a storm to others, and the journeys she takes him on lead toward the still country that lies at her back. MacDonald wraps a story of London poverty and a sick child inside a fairy tale, asking gently what death might really be.
